The NOBCChE Collaborative's purpose is to develop a pipeline of academic career opportunities for NOBCChE undergraduate, graduate, and post-doctoral members that helps to achieve NOBCChE’s overall mission and seeks to improve the representation of people of color in academia.
This Collaborative model was co-founded by former Vice President Kemal Catalan (NOBCChE 2015-2017) and currently consists of two charters that have worked together to build micro-networks that support underrepresented minorities at the undergraduate, graduate, postdoctoral, and even faculty levels.
